Green light for lipid fingerprinting

Biochim Biophys Acta Mol Cell Biol Lipids. 2017 Aug;1862(8):782-785. doi: 10.1016/j.bbalip.2017.04.005. Epub 2017 Apr 20.

Abstract

The use of targeted lipidomic approaches for the analysis of plant lipids has steadily increased during recent years. We review recent developments of these methods and suggest the introduction of discovery lipidomics as additional approach through a new workflow, lipid fingerprinting, that integrates the advantages of shotgun lipidomics (quantitative data) with LC-MS-based strategies (higher resolution and/or coverage).
